The story of John Ensign CURTIS began in 1670 in Stratford, Fairfield, Connecticut, United States. John Ensign CURTIS married Joanna Burr, and had children including Abigail Curtis, Abigail Curtiss, David Curtis, Elikim Curtis, Elizabeth Curtis, Esther Curtis, Eunice Curtis, Hannah Curtis, Harriet Curtis, Joanna Curtis, John Curtis, Nathan Curtiss, Olive Curtis, Peter Curtis, Stephen Curtiss. John Ensign CURTIS passed away in 1754 in Woodbury, Litchfield, Connecticut, United States.
